WebWhen a person enters your property, regardless of whom, they have a reasonable expectation that they will not be injured. This is known as the standard of care owed to anyone on their property. Essentially, this means the owner or occupier of the property must maintain a relatively safe environment for all persons. WebWhen a dog bite occurs in or around an animal care facility, that facility may be legally responsible. There are many types of facilities responsible for keeping animals—and the people they might interact with—safe. Some of these facilities include dog shelters, animal hotels, grooming services, veterinary clinics, pet stores, kennels, etc.
